Summer 2013 Intensive Program


Dates:
Tuesday, July 2nd - Friday, July 26th, 2013

These 4 weeks of classes involve 120 hours of classroom instruction (methodology, grammar, workshops). Classes run Monday - Friday, 9:00am - 4:30pm.

Practicum placement to follow program in the summer or in the fall. Please allow a minimum of 2 weeks to complete the placement.

NOTE: Only the first 10 students registered in this program will be guaranteed a practicum placement.

 


Fall 2013 Program



Dates: Monday, September 16th, 2013 - Friday, October 25th, 2013


These 6 weeks of classes involve 120 hours of classroom instruction (methodology, grammar, workshops) and 10 hours of classroom observation. Classes run Monday  - Friday, 9:00am - 4:00pm.

Please note: Mandatory program orientation will be help Monday, September 16th from 9:00am - 2:00pm. Following this, all subsequent Monday sessions are not part of regular coursework, but are strongly encouraged. This is a change from previous terms.

Practicum placement to follow program. Please allow a minimum of 2 weeks to complete the placement.

The courses for the full-time ESL Teacher Certificate Program costs $2000. The practicum placement fee is an additional $250, and can be paid when the student registers for the placement. Payment plans are available.
